The Benefits of Learning English
Increase Your Job Opportunities
Learning English can greatly expand your job opportunities and increase your chances of career success. In today’s globalized world, English has become the lingua franca of business and commerce. It is the most widely spoken language in the world, and being able to speak English fluently can open doors to jobs both at home and abroad. Employers often prioritize candidates with strong English skills, as it demonstrates good communication abilities and the potential to work with clients and colleagues from diverse backgrounds. Whether you aspire to work in multinational corporations or international organizations, having a solid command of English can give you a competitive edge and improve your career prospects.
English language skills can also be advantageous in many specific industries, such as tourism, hospitality, and information technology. These sectors often require employees who can comfortably interact with customers, clients, or colleagues from different countries. By investing time and effort into learning English, you can position yourself as a valuable asset in these industries and increase your chances of securing employment or advancing within your current workplace.
Furthermore, learning English can also open up entrepreneurial opportunities. English-speaking countries, such as the United States and the United Kingdom, offer vibrant business environments and attractive markets for startups. By mastering the English language, you can tap into these markets, establish connections, and potentially expand your ventures globally. English proficiency can unlock a world of business possibilities and give you a competitive advantage in the increasingly interconnected global marketplace.
Enhance Your Personal and Social Life
In addition to its professional benefits, learning English can significantly enhance your personal and social life. English is the language of international communication, and being able to speak it allows you to connect with people from all walks of life and different cultures. Whether you’re traveling, making friends online, or participating in international events and conferences, English proficiency can facilitate meaningful interactions and enrich your experiences.
Learning English can also broaden your horizons by giving you access to a vast array of literature, films, music, and other forms of media. It allows you to explore the works of renowned English-speaking authors, watch movies without subtitles, or understand song lyrics that resonate with people worldwide. Engaging with English-language media can expose you to diverse perspectives, stimulating intellectual growth, and promoting intercultural understanding.
Moreover, mastering English can help you break down language barriers and engage in cross-cultural exchanges. It enables you to appreciate different cultures, challenge stereotypes, and build bridges between individuals with different backgrounds. Through language, you can embrace diversity and foster a sense of global citizenship, contributing to a more inclusive and interconnected society.
Boost Your Cognitive Skills and Brain Health
Learning a new language, such as English, is not only beneficial for communication and cultural enrichment but also for brain health and cognitive skills. Research has shown that bilingualism can enhance cognitive abilities, including memory, problem-solving, and decision-making. When you learn a new language, your brain becomes more flexible and adaptable, as it constantly switches between linguistic systems.
English, with its complex grammar and extensive vocabulary, provides a challenging yet rewarding learning experience. It forces your brain to think differently, expand its linguistic abilities, and develop new neural connections. This cognitive stimulation can have long-term benefits, helping to delay the onset of age-related cognitive decline and neurodegenerative diseases.
Furthermore, language learning has been found to improve multitasking and attention skills. Juggling different aspects of language, such as listening, speaking, reading, and writing, requires concentration and mental agility. By regularly practicing English, you can sharpen your focus, train your memory, and enhance your overall cognitive performance.
